Transaction 43befd1ba107d2d653de84700e8aaa09e5251a40bc9dccd0ea61ef971f9b7f2e

1 Input
2 Outputs
  • 43befd1ba107d2d653de84700e8aaa09e5251a40bc9dccd0ea61ef971f9b7f2e:0
  • value  920637
    address  391T2qUuwM5B72dvjKpm4YV8N1SX82fB9J
  • 43befd1ba107d2d653de84700e8aaa09e5251a40bc9dccd0ea61ef971f9b7f2e:1
  • value  125266011
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C